Located in the Sandhills of North Carolina, Fayetteville is well-known as a military city. Much of the population consists of armed services members stationed at Fort Bragg, a large military installation. Fayetteville is also home to four-year universities and community colleges. Whether you are a college student, a soldier, or a traditional family, Fayetteville has apartments and houses for rent that will meet your housing needs.

The cost of living in Fayetteville is very reasonable, less than North Carolina's average as well as the national average cost of living. Very affordable apartments are located 10 minutes away from Fayetteville's shopping centers and downtown area. More luxurious apartments are situated between Fort Bragg and Fayetteville's main shopping mall.

Focus on Location

The city of Fayetteville stretches across more than 147 square miles. Fayetteville is the sixth largest city in North Carolina. While apartment searching in Fayetteville, consider the proximity to your workplace, medical centers, schools and entertainment. The upscale apartments and houses for rent may be located farther away from the busy downtown area.

Keep Your Budget in Mind

Before beginning the rental application process for an apartment, townhome, or house in Fayetteville, carefully examine your budget. Make sure you select an apartment or house with a reasonable rent. A suggested rent would be about 50 percent of your income. Don't forget you will still have to pay for other expenses, such as transportation, insurance, utilities, and groceries. The landlord or property management company will want proof of income to determine if you can pay your rent each month.
